Understanding the Role of a Branch Banking Team Leader

Before delving into how to excel, let’s first understand what the role entails. As a branch banking team leader, you'll manage the daily operations of a bank branch, ensuring efficient service delivery and achieving profitability targets. Your role involves leading a team, managing customer relationships, overseeing branch operations, and implementing banking strategies.

Main Responsibilities

  • Leadership and team management
  • Customer relationship management
  • Operational efficiency
  • Financial target achievement
  • Regulatory compliance

Developing Leadership Skills

Leadership is at the core of a branch banking team leader's role. It's not just about overseeing tasks but also about inspiring and motivating your team to achieve their best. Here’s how you can enhance your leadership skills:

  • Communication: Clear and concise communication is essential. Ensure every team member understands their roles and responsibilities, and keep open lines of communication.
  • Decision-making: Make informed, timely decisions. Weigh options, consider risks, and consult with your team when necessary.
  • Conflict resolution: Address conflicts swiftly and fairly. Learn to mediate and find a balanced solution that satisfies all parties.
  • Influence and inspiration: Lead by example. Be the role model your team looks up to for guidance and support.

Enhancing Customer Service

Exceptional customer service sets apart a successful branch. It builds customer trust, loyalty, and positive banking experiences. Here’s how you can foster excellent customer service:

  • Customer-first mentality: Make sure your team prioritizes customer needs and delivers personalized banking solutions.
  • Feedback and adaptation: Encourage feedback and be willing to adapt or improve services based on customer inputs.
  • Service training: Regular training sessions can enhance your team’s service skills and keep them updated on banking products and services.

Mastering Operational Management

Efficient operation management is crucial for a branch's success. Managing operations includes a keen eye on all processes to ensure they are efficient and compliant. Here’s how you can master this aspect:

  • Process optimization: Regularly review and streamline processes for increased efficiency and effectiveness.
  • Performance metrics: Monitor key performance indicators (KPIs) to measure branch success and identify improvement areas.
  • Risk management: Implement proactive measures to identify, assess, and mitigate risks associated with branch operations.

Technology Integration

Incorporating technology can significantly enhance operational processes. From automated services to digital banking solutions, ensure your branch stays competitive by embracing the latest technology.

Driving Financial Performance

Meeting and exceeding financial targets is a primary goal for every branch. Here’s how you can achieve and surpass financial benchmarks:

  • Actionable financial strategies: Develop and implement financial strategies that align with your branch’s goals.
  • Revenue growth: Focus on driving revenue through diverse banking products and services.
  • Cost management: Keep expenses in check without compromising service quality. Regular audits can help identify areas to cut costs.

Ensuring Compliance and Security

Security and compliance are crucial in the banking sector. A failure in these aspects can lead to significant not just financial but also reputational damage. Commit to maintaining regulatory compliance and robust security measures:

  • Regulatory knowledge: Stay informed about local, national, and international banking regulations.
  • Regular audits: Conduct frequent audits to ensure compliance and identify any potential security threats.
  • Training: Regularly train your team to recognize, prevent, and respond to security threats.

Building a Strong Team Culture

A strong, cohesive team culture is vital for high performance and job satisfaction. Foster a supportive and inclusive environment where every team member feels valued and motivated.

  • Open communication: Encourage open dialogue and feedback among team members.
  • Recognition and rewards: Recognize and reward performance and efforts. This boosts morale and encourages continued excellence.
  • Team-building activities: Organize regular team-building events to strengthen relationships.
